41 bonded labourers rescued from five worksites in Sri Sathya Sai district

ANANTAPUR: The Sri Sathya Sai district administration rescued 41 workers, including women and children, from five worksites in the district on Thursday.

Notably, the rescue followed a complaint lodged by two young men in their early twenties. This person escaped from the worksites and reached Maharashtra.

Meanwhile, the men approached social workers and sought support to rescue their parents and grandparents. This person were still working at the sites. With the support of social workers, they lodged a complaint.

Based on which, the Sri Sathya Sai district authorities initiated action and coordinated with the concerned authorities in AP. During the operation, authorities identified multiple worksites where workers were allegedly being engaged in bonded labour.

Notably, the owner of the worksites is documented to be from Maharashtra. The workers had allegedly remained in bonded labour for over three years.

Authorities rescued the workers from five worksites located at Chinthalapalli village (two locations), Puleru Road near Gorantla town, Thummarayuni Thanda and Talamarla village. While Talamarla village falls under Kothacheruvu mandal of the Puttaparthi revenue division, four locations fall under Gorantla mandal of the Penukonda revenue division.

Rescued workers informed office-holders they were allegedly beaten, forced to work long hours and denied wages after receiving advances of `20, 000-50, 000. Police detained two persons linked to the worksites.
